			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Did you know?:</p>
<p>&#8220;A flock of chicks can help families from Cameroon to the Caribbean add nourishing, life-sustaining eggs to their inadequate diets. The protein in just one egg is a nutritious gift for a hungry child. Protein-packed eggs from even a single chicken can make a life-saving difference.&#8221;</p>
<p><a href="http://alittlesliceofheaven.files.wordpress.com/2009/12/chicken_large.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-49" title="Chicken_Large" src="http://alittlesliceofheaven.files.wordpress.com/2009/12/chicken_large.jpg?w=235&#038;h=235" alt="" width="235" height="235" /></a></p>
<p>And, for just $20 this holiday season you can buy a <a href="http://www.heifer.org/site/c.edJRKQNiFiG/b.2667525/?msource=kw2104">flock of chicks</a> and help a family through <a href="http://www.heifer.org">Heifer International</a>.</p>
<p>&#8220;Heifer helps many hungry families with a starter flock of 10 to 50 chicks. A good hen can lay up to 200 eggs a year &#8211; plenty to eat, share or sell. With Heifer recipients&#8217; commitment to pass on the offspring and training, the exponential impact of adding chickens to communities in poverty is truly a model that helps end hunger and poverty. Because chickens require little space and can thrive on readily available food scraps, families can make money from the birds without spending much. And chickens help control insects and fertilize gardens.&#8221;</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>It’s slightly obvious, right? But, in this case I don’t just simply mean having empathy. Let’s take it a step further and act on it. Consider the process known as “<a href="http://dschool.stanford.edu/big_picture/design_thinking.php">design thinking</a>” (thanks to Stanford’s d. school and my highly influential big brother!):</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-35" title="Design_Thinking_Stanford" src="http://alittlesliceofheaven.files.wordpress.com/2009/10/design_thinking_stanford2.jpg?w=499&#038;h=332" alt="Design_Thinking_Stanford" width="499" height="332" /></p>
<p>The first part of it – understanding and observing – is where empathy comes into play. Instead of developing products for the sake of developing products, or developing a process for the sake of developing a process, think first about actual needs and seek to truly understand the “issue” at hand.</p>
<p>George Kembel, in his talk on <em><a href="http://fora.tv/2009/08/14/George_Kembel_Awakening_Creativity">Awakening Creativity</a></em> said: “If you focus only on the innovations (that is an outcome-only focus), you risk killing creativity. But if you focus on the innovators, one thing I’ve learned is you will most likely get both. In the end, creativity may be a latent capacity that is available to all of us&#8230;that design thinking may be a kind of process that can begin to awaken it in more people than we had otherwise realized or imagined. The transformation to a more innovative culture requires the hard work of reshaping organizations and teams. Less we get overwhelmed by the enormity or the responsibility of the task, let us always remember that it always begins in our own individual transformation. And that gives us a place to start. And the rest, I trust, will follow.&#8221;</p>
<p>Design thinking has been applied to improve international social issues – read about <a href="http://embraceglobal.org/main/why">Embrace</a>, a low-cost infant warmer, as an example – but it can also be applied to every day situations. So, while we can’t all travel and develop solutions to make a drastic change in the world, we can make changes within our own work environments and daily lives. To get started, try today’s little slice of heaven: a spoonful of <em>empathy</em>.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div dir="ltr">How would you describe the &#8220;smell&#8221; of Fall? I vote for a combination of leaves, apples and pumpkins. It never fails, every year I always end up buying some kind of apple flavored Yankee candle&#8230;apple cider (by the way, Starbucks and &#8211; on a more local note &#8211; Square One in Lancaster, PA both have terrific caramel apple cider!)&#8230;apple dumplings&#8230;and, I make endless quantities of pumpkin bread! I use a delicious recipe that was passed down from my mom.</div>
<div dir="ltr"></div>
<div dir="ltr">Here it is for you to enjoy!:</div>
<div dir="ltr"></div>
<div dir="ltr"><strong>Pumpkin Bread</strong></div>
<div dir="ltr"><em><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">Cream together:</span></em></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">1/2 cup oil</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">2 eggs</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">1 1/2 cups granulated sugar</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">1 cup pumpkin</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><em><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">Mix in:</span></em></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">1 3/4 cup flour</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">1 tsp salt</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">1/2 tsp cinnamon</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">1/2 tsp nutmeg</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">1/2 tsp cloves</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;"><br />
</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">In a separate mug, heat 1/3 cup water&#8230;  then mix 1 tsp baking soda into the hot water (it will fizz)</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">Pour the water/baking soda mixture into the  bowl containing everything else<br />
</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">Grease bread pan</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">Pour the pumpkin mixture into the bread  pan</span></div>
<div dir="ltr"><span style="font-family:Arial;font-size:x-small;">Bake at 350 degrees for 40-60 minutes (it  might need slightly more depending on your oven)</span></div>
